Web24 feb. 2024 · Bone grafting. This procedure is performed when periodontitis destroys the bone around your tooth root. The graft may be made from small bits of your own bone, or the bone may be made of artificial material or donated. The bone graft helps prevent tooth loss by holding your tooth in place. Because of this alveolar resorptive pattern after tooth extraction, bone grafting the extraction socket after tooth extraction procedures has become a solution that attempts to limit the amount of hard- and soft-tissue loss.

WebFor alloplastic bone replacement, the material produced mimics the natural bone. Most often the material used for making alloplastic graft is calcium phosphate.
